The role

A summary of the role (3-5 sentences).

What you'll do

  • Support Public Finance Analysis and Evidence Generation
  • Implement the Public Finance for Children (PF4C) Strategy
  • Facilitate internal and external coordination with stakeholders
  • Manage program resources, budgets, and reporting
  • Organize capacity building workshops and advocacy efforts

What it takes

  • Bachelor's degree required
  • 7 years of experience in public management or budget allocations
  • Excellent drafting and communication skills
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and database management
  • Ability to work in multicultural teams

What you'll bring

Public management and budget allocationsOral and written communicationDrafting and reportingInterpersonal skillsCultural sensitivityMicrosoft Office proficiency

How we treat you

Volunteer living allowance, danger/hardship differential, medical and life insurance, annual leave, learning platform access.
